Hydrodynamic Harmony: Boats, Engines, and the Open Sea
Achieving smooth sailing on the open ocean demands a delicate balance between robust engines and the elegant movements of the boat. This coordination is known as hydrodynamic stability, where every component works in agreement to reduce resistance and optimize performance.
The shape of a boat, its design, plays a vital role in achieving hydrodynamic harmony. Sculptural hulls slice through the water with lower drag, allowing for faster speeds and better fuel efficiency.
- Engines that complement the boat's design are just as important.
- They must deliver strength while remaining refined.
Beyond motor power, the use of advanced materials and construction techniques can greatly enhance hydrodynamic performance. Lightweight yet strong materials like carbon fiber reduce overall weight, allowing boats to move with greater agility.
